Diabetics can donate blood since diabetes is a disease condition affecting insulin production which is done in the pancreas. It is not a blood borne disease.
You can't donate blood if you are taking medication for diabetes maintenance such as insulin injections because it will affect the blood sugar levels of the recipients. Acute hypoglycemia is a dreadful state.
